5308638
0x18ef38af3624ed7edc0154e6033fae870d2c17e88128c62e2a3452909c0062cb
Transactions0
Height5308638
Confirmations9724622
Timestamp819 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xcf292c6550910507
Bits
Difficulty0xe00dc7d